Does Windows 10 install Nvidia drivers?

Go to the Settings app > Update & security > Windows update and click on Check for updates. Allow Windows 10 to check if there are any NVIDIA drivers available to download. Most likely an update will be available to install. Wait until that update has been installed along with the others.

How do I Update my GTX 1650 graphics card?

Go to the NVIDIA driver download page. Choose GeForce GTX 1650 from the product list and select your operating system. Then click Search. To download the optimized driver for the latest games, choose Game Ready Drivers for Download Type, or you can select Studio Drivers for design purposes.

How do I install Nvidia on Windows 10?

To Install the NVIDIA Display Driver:

  1. Run the NVIDIA Display Driver installer. The Display Driver Installer appears.
  2. Follow installer directions until final screen. Do not reboot.
  3. When prompted, select No, I will restart my computer later.
  4. Click Finish.
